Abstract

The present invention relates to an improved carrying tray comprising: a substantially planar surface having a top surface and bottom surface; and a handle placed within a cavity at the underside of the bottom surface, wherein the cavity is adapted to receive and retain the handle so that said handle does not extend from the bottom surface of the tray, and wherein the handle is easily pulled into an open-position to embrace the user's palm and provide improved control for carrying said tray, and easily returns into the cavity and back to a close-position when the user removes his palm.

1 . An improved carrying tray ( 10 ) comprising:
 a) a substantially planar surface ( 12 ) having a top surface and bottom surface;   b) a cavity ( 26 ) at the underside of the bottom surface; and   c) a handle ( 16 ) placed within said cavity ( 26 ),   wherein:   the cavity ( 26 ) is adapted to receive and retain the handle ( 16 ) so that said handle ( 16 ) does not extend from the bottom surface of the tray ( 10 ),   the handle ( 16 ) is adapted to be easily pulled away from the bottom surface into an open-position, to embrace the user's palm and provide improved control for carrying said tray ( 10 ), and   when the palm is removed, the handle ( 16 ) easily returns into the cavity ( 26 ) and back to a close-position.   
     
     
         2 . A tray ( 10 ) according to  claim 1 , further comprising a pointer ( 17 ) indicating either the location and orientation of the handle ( 16 ) or indication where the user should insert his hand from in order to arrive to the handle ( 16 ) in the right direction.

         5 . A tray ( 10 ) according to  claim 1 , wherein the bottom surface has ridges ( 29 ) so that the handle ( 16 ) does not extend from said ridges ( 29 ). 
     
     
         6 . A tray ( 10 ) according to  claim 5 , wherein said ridges ( 29 ) may form the cavity ( 26 ) holding the handle ( 16 ) and in which the handle moves from close- to open-position and vice versa. 
     
     
         7 . The handle ( 16 ) of the tray of  claim 1 , which is attached thereto in a permanent manner or is removably attached to the tray ( 10 ).

         18 . A handle-system unit ( 14 ) comprising essentially of:
 a) a coupling base ( 18 ) comprising an internal cavity ( 26 ) at its underside; and   b) a handle ( 16 ) placed within said cavity ( 26 );   wherein the unit ( 14 ) may be attached to the underside of any tray in any size and shape, and wherein   the cavity ( 26 ) is adapted to receive and retain the handle ( 16 ) so that said handle ( 16 ) does not extend from the bottom surface of the base ( 18 ),   the handle ( 16 ) is adapted to be easily pulled away from the bottom surface into an open-position, to embrace the user's palm, and provide improved control for carrying said attached tray, and   when the palm is removed, the handle ( 16 ) easily returns into the cavity ( 26 ) and back to a close-position.   
     
     
         19 . The unit ( 14 ) of  claim 18 , which is attached to a tray by any one of the following means: snap-fit, gluing, screwing and welding. 
     
     
         20 . The base ( 18 ) of  claim 18 , which is rotatable, thereby allowing changing the orientation and location of the handle ( 16 ).
